private void buttonAdd_Click(object sender, EventArgs e) { if (img != null) { if (string.IsNullOrEmpty(textBoxDescricaoProd.Text)) { FormMessage.ShowMessegeWarning("Informe uma descrição para este prêmio!"); textBoxDescricaoProd.Select(); return; } infoProd = new ProdutoInfo { produtodescricao = textBoxDescricaoProd.Text, produtofoto = ConvertImagem(img), produtovalor = Convert.ToDecimal(textBoxValor.Text) }; negSort = new SorteioNegocio(); negSort.ExecutarProduto(enumCRUD.insert, infoProd); FormMessage.ShowMessegeInfo("Prêmio lançado com sucesso!"); pictureBox1.Image = Properties.Resources.portateis; textBoxDescricaoProd.Clear(); textBoxDescricaoProd.Select(); textBoxValor.Text = "1,00"; FormProduto formProduto = (FormProduto)Application.OpenForms["FormProduto"]; formProduto.PreencherLista(); } else { FormMessage.ShowMessegeWarning("Selecione uma imagem para este prêmio!"); } }
private void buttonPict_Click(object sender, EventArgs e) { this.Cursor = Cursors.WaitCursor; using (FormProduto formProduto = new FormProduto()) { formProduto.ShowDialog(this); } this.Cursor = Cursors.Default; }
private void UserControlProdDescricao_MouseEnter(object sender, EventArgs e) { FormProduto p = (FormProduto)this.Parent.Parent; p.LimparSelecionado(); if (this.Enabled) { this.BackColor = Color.Gray; } }